Petitioner was appointed as a Craft Teacher in 1994 and is currently working under the 8th Respondent School. He belongs to ST (Valmiki) community, obtained ST certificate in 1989 and was appointed based on merit. While so, an inquiry has been initiated by the 3rd Respondent - Commissioner and Director of School Education based on a complaint from an outsider. The Assistant Tribal Welfare Officer, Dammapeta was directed to conduct an inquiry into petitioner's social status, as it is alleged that he does not belong to ST community. According to petitioner, similar inquiry was conducted earlier in 2022 vide Proceedings dated 22-06-2022, during which, petitioner produced all the relevant documents and the case was closed confirming his social status as ST.
1.1 It is the case of petitioner, however, the 5th respondent Collector, Bhadradri-Kothagudem again directed the 7th respondent Deputy Director, Tribal Welfare to conduct an inquiry on the same issue vide Proceedings dated 20-12-2024 and 04-12-2024, impugned in this Writ Petition.
